Cultural Center "Rukh Ordo" named after Ch. Aitmatov

"Rukh Ordo" is a one-of-a-kind open-air museum on the coast of Lake Issyk-Kul in the city of Cholpon-Ata.

The complex includes 10 mini museums, including: “House-Museum of Ch. Aitmatov”, “Hall of Kyrgyz Art and Culture”, art and photo galleries, “Sayakbai Karalaev’s Gazebo”, “Treasury of Knowledge” and five chapels, each which represents one of the world's faiths, namely: Islam, Catholicism, Orthodoxy, Buddhism and Judaism, as a symbol of the fact that God is one for all.

Also on the territory of the complex there are exhibitions of dozens of sculptures and hundreds of paintings made in a variety of techniques, handicrafts that were carefully passed down from generation to generation. At the same time, the exhibition fund “Rukh Ordo” is constantly replenished with new and interesting exhibits.
